United Center Logistics
United Center has official Uber Shuttle information for major events, proving post-event transportation is a real pain point. The venue also publishes bag policies — small bags only, no backpacks. Before your event, remind your group about the bag policy so nobody is turned away at security. Your driver coordinates pickup and drop-off based on event traffic patterns and road closures.

Bulls vs Blackhawks vs Concerts
Bulls and Blackhawks games follow similar patterns — evening games with 2.5-hour runtimes. Concerts vary by artist and set length. For all United Center events, book at least 3-4 hours: pre-event pickup and bar/dinner stop (1-2 hours), drop-off, wait during event, and post-event pickup. Rideshare Surge Comparison
After a Bulls or Blackhawks game, rideshare surge pricing can hit 3-5x normal rates. A group of 20 paying $80+ each for surge-priced Ubers is spending $1,600+ just to get home — often more than a party bus rental for the entire evening. Plus, your crew stays together instead of splitting into six separate cars.

Chicago Planning Tips for United Center
Use these local planning checks before finalizing the route and vehicle.
Traffic buffer
Chicago traffic can change quickly around downtown, expressways, airports, stadiums, festivals, and major conventions. Build more time than a normal map estimate.
Loading access
Ask every venue where a party bus, limousine, Sprinter, or coach bus may legally load. Valet lanes and front entrances are not always available to larger vehicles.
One point person
Designate one passenger to manage the headcount, route, contact details, and timing updates. Conflicting instructions from several passengers create delays.
Stop order
Arrange stops in a logical sequence. Backtracking between neighborhoods can add substantial drive time and overtime.
